Bus station hiking trails in the Troodos Mountains offer access to a diverse landscape characterized by dense pine forests, rocky terrains, and picturesque valleys. The region features unique geological formations, including an ophiolite complex, and is home to Mount Olympus, Cyprus's highest peak at 1,952 meters. Hikers can explore a network of trails that traverse varied elevations, from lower slopes to higher mountain passes, often revealing panoramic views.

The Caledonia Falls in Cyprus are located near the village of Platres in Troodos. This beautiful waterfall is one of the highest in Cyprus and is surrounded by forest and is most popular in summer when it offers a cool and shady retreat from the strong midday sun. It was a nice short hike.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many bus station hiking trails are available in the Troodos Mountains?

There are nearly 200 hiking trails in the Troodos Mountains that are accessible from bus stations. This includes 50 easy routes, 129 moderate routes, and 18 difficult routes, offering options for various skill levels.

Are there any family-friendly bus-accessible hikes in the Troodos Mountains?

Yes, the Troodos Mountains offer several family-friendly trails accessible by bus. An excellent option is the Caledonia Waterfalls loop from Pano Platres, which is an easy route leading to the beautiful Caledonia Waterfalls. Many trails also feature designated picnic areas.

Can I find circular hiking routes that start and end at a bus station?

Absolutely. Many of the bus-accessible trails in the Troodos Mountains are circular, allowing you to return to your starting point without needing additional transport. For example, the moderate Caledonia Waterfalls – Pouziaris Peak loop from Pano Platres offers a scenic round trip.

What kind of natural attractions can I expect to see on these trails?

The bus-accessible trails in the Troodos Mountains lead to a variety of natural attractions. You can discover stunning waterfalls like the Caledonia Waterfalls and Millomeris Waterfall, explore unique geological formations, and enjoy panoramic views from spots like the Troodos Plateau or the View of the Troodos Mountains. The region is also home to dense pine forests and diverse flora.

Are there any challenging bus-accessible hikes for experienced hikers?

Yes, for experienced hikers seeking a challenge, there are difficult routes accessible by bus. The Madari Peak – Madari Fire Lookout loop from Spilia is a demanding option, offering significant elevation gain and rewarding views across the mountainous landscape.

What do other hikers say about the trails in the Troodos Mountains?

The komoot community highly rates the hiking experience in the Troodos Mountains, with an average score of 4.5 stars from over 6,700 reviews. Hikers frequently praise the well-maintained paths, the refreshing natural beauty of the forests and waterfalls, and the stunning panoramic views.

Are there any trails that offer views of the coastline or distant areas?

Yes, several trails provide expansive views. For instance, the moderate Moutti tis Sotiras Viewpoint – View of the Akamas Peninsula loop from Marine protected area of Chalavro offers breathtaking vistas that can extend to the Akamas Peninsula and even Morphou Bay on clear days.

What is the best time of year to hike in the Troodos Mountains using public transport?

The Troodos Mountains offer hiking opportunities year-round. Spring (April-May) and autumn (September-October) are ideal for pleasant temperatures and vibrant scenery. Summer provides a refreshing escape from coastal heat, while winter transforms the area into a snowy landscape, suitable for those prepared for colder conditions and potential snow on higher trails.

Are there any moderate bus-accessible trails that include waterfalls?

Certainly. A popular moderate route is the Kalidonia Waterfalls Trailhead – Pouziaris Peak loop from Pano Platres. This trail allows you to experience the beauty of the Caledonia Waterfalls while enjoying a more extensive hike through the surrounding nature.

Can I find information on what to wear for hiking in the Troodos Mountains?

Given the diverse terrain and varying altitudes, it's advisable to wear sturdy hiking boots, layer your clothing to adapt to changing temperatures, and carry rain gear, especially during cooler months. Sun protection is also crucial year-round. Always check the local weather forecast before heading out.

Are there any gorges or unique geological features to explore on bus-accessible routes?

The Troodos Mountains are renowned for their unique geological formations, being a UNESCO Global Geopark. While many trails traverse varied terrain, the Avakas Gorge is a notable geological highlight in the broader region, offering a dramatic landscape to explore.
